Complete Buying Guide for Best Long-Handled Tools For Vegetable Gardens
Choosing the right long-handled tools for your vegetable garden can significantly enhance your gardening experience. The best tools will not only improve efficiency but also reduce strain on the body, making your gardening tasks more enjoyable and productive.
Key Features to Look For
- Ergonomic Design: Look for tools with comfortable grips and adjustable handles to minimize physical strain.
- Durability: High-quality materials that resist rust and wear ensure longevity and reliable performance.
- Weight: Lightweight tools reduce fatigue, making them easier to handle over extended periods.
- Versatility: Tools that serve multiple functions can save space and money.
Important Materials
When selecting tools, prioritize materials like stainless steel or high-carbon steel for blades and tines, as they offer excellent durability and resistance to rust. For handles, consider fiberglass or hardwood for their strength and longevity. Avoid tools with flimsy or plastic components, as they may not withstand regular use.
Essential Factors to Consider
Consider the size and type of your garden when choosing long-handled tools. Tools like hoes and rakes come in various sizes and configurations to suit different gardening needs. Ensure that the handle length is appropriate for your height to prevent back strain. Additionally, look for tools with replaceable parts, which can extend their lifespan and provide better value over time.
